Why do we give?
Proverbs 3:9, "Honor the LORD with your wealth, with the firstfruits of all your crops…"
Jesus taught that our money is an indicator of our hearts and Paul taught that if we are loved by God and love Him in return we would give cheerfully, sacrificially, and regularly.
First Baptist teaches that God is the owner of everything, including our money and possessions. When we give, we give back to God what He already owns. Our giving is an indication of trust, discipleship, and commitment. We believe that the minimum biblical standard for giving is 10%, commonly called a “tithe”.
The church offers periodic seminars on biblical money management. These seminars provide in-depth study of what God’s word teaches about money. They also help in teaching money management principles both scripturally and practically. Jesus Christ had more to say about money than almost any other subject in the Bible.
